The Sustainable Energy Authority of Ireland (SEAI), and the Department of Education and Youth (DEY) have agreed to collaborate on the delivery of an Energy Pathfinder Programme for the Education sector and require a Lead Mechanical and Electrical (M and E) Engineering Design Consultant to deliver the Louth and Meath Schools Biomass Project under the Pathfinder 2025/2026 Programme. This bundle, representing a single tender competition, will comprise up to 6 schools located in Counties Louth and Meath. This initiative aims to reduce CO2 emissions in schools by piloting biomass boiler projects, complete with a fuel store, which will be housed in a prefabricated energy cabin and craned into a location adjacent to the existing school boiler house. The Lead Design Consultant must be an M and E engineering specialist with demonstrable experience in Irish school design and delivery of projects of similar scale and complexity. The Consultant will manage the full design process, including but not limited to: Coordination and procurement of all necessary specialist skill providers as outlined in the Suitability Assessment Questionnaire. Provision of all additional services required to complete the project, either in-house or subcontracted, included within the tendered fee. Responsibility for managing and contracting any other design disciplines necessary for project delivery. The successful Design Consultant will be expected to deliver the project successfully through all five stages of the CWMF. The Project Execution Plan sets out the key deliverables throughout each stage of each school biomass project.
